is a specialized utility or workflow designed to compress video files into ZIP archives, making it easier to store, share, and manage large media libraries . While video files are already compressed using codecs (like H.264 or HEVC), "zipping" them provides a convenient container for bulk transfers and organization. Why Use Vid2Zip?
